Colin Ong is a member of the Brunei, English and Singapore Bars. He is highly experienced as barrister, lead counsel and arbitrator in large or complex international commercial disputes.

He is often engaged by other Singapore law firms and law firms in Brunei; England and others to act as lead counsel in arbitrations and in court matters. He is also regularly instructed as lead counsel and to provide advocacy and strategic advice to law firms in Brunei, China, England, Hong Kong, Malaysia, Indonesia, Thailand and other countries in large quantum international arbitration matters taking place in those countries as well as in major seats of arbitration.

In 2010, he became the first non-head of state or senior judge from ASEAN to be elected as a Master of the Bench of the Inner Temple. Dr. Ong is also the first ASEAN national lawyer to be appointed English Queen’s Counsel (now King’s Counsel).

He is well known for his work in areas including banking and finance, construction and infrastructure projects (airports, bridges, pipe-lines; ports; roads), insurance, energy disputes (coal mining and supply disputes, production sharing contracts, electricity supply, gas contracts and oil exploration joint ventures), intellectual property, information technology, insolvency shipping, telecoms, technology transfer, and general commercial trade related matters.

He has acted as lead counsel or counsel in many arbitrations governed under civil law as well as cases governed under common law applying most major institutional rules as well as ad hoc cases under UNCITRAL rules. Dr Ong has led teams that have included Senior Counsel in Hong Kong and Singapore, and also other English Silks in complex large quantum arbitrations pertaining to business and commercial disputes, several of which have exceeded claims of US$1 Billion.

His clients have included state owned entities, financial institutions and other major commercial corporations and high net-worth individuals. Dr Ong is equally comfortable in acting in cases governed under Civil law as well as cases governed under Common law.

Some notable reported local cases he has been involved in include acting as lead counsel for the Indonesian national gas company before the Singapore Court of Appeal in PT Perusahaan Gas Negara v CRW [2015] SGCA 30. At the 2016 GAR Awards in Shanghai, the set of split decisions by the Court of Appeal was named runner up as the most important decision globally of 2015. Dr Ong was lead counsel in an earlier international arbitration which subsequently led to FIDIC amending the Standard 1999 FIDIC Form Contracts in April 2013 and issuing an urgent FIDIC Guidance Memorandum.

Dr Ong was among the first few Chartered Arbitrators in the ASEAN region, He has taught at various CIArb and SIArb fellowship courses over a 15 year period. He also teaches advocacy in various countries and has published in this area as well as on arbitration. He is also the co-author of ‘Costs in International Arbitration’ (Lexis Nexis 2013), the first specialised book on costs in international arbitration. He is also co-editor of ‘Interim Measures in International Arbitration‘ (Juris 2014).  Dr Ong is on the editorial board of several international journals, including Arbitration (CIArb), Butterworths Journal of International Banking & Financial Law, Badan Arbitrase Nasional Indonesia Journal, China-ASEAN Law Review Dispute Resolution International and Maritime Risk International.

Arbitral Appointments and Arbitration Counsel

Dr Ong has been appointed arbitrator or has acted as counsel in over 350 international cases in both commercial and ad hoc investor state disputes governed under most major institutional rules including AAA, BANI, CIETAC, HKIAC, ICC, ICDR, KLRCA, LCIA, LMAA, SIAC, SCMA, TAI, UNCITRAL and WIPO rules. The cases have also been governed by Civil and Common Law and many applicable laws including English, French; Hong Kong, Indian, Indonesian, Japanese, Korean, Laos Malaysian, Mongolian, New York, Philippine, PRC, Singapore, Sri Lankan; Swiss, Thai, UAE and Vietnam law. He was brought up in a trilingual background and his languages include English, Chinese and Malay. He is one of the very few lawyers and arbitrators able to handle Indonesia-related arbitration cases conducted in Bahasa Indonesia and governed under Indonesian law. He has also been involved in many PRC law governed arbitrations and has heard many cases in China and Hong Kong.

He has been and is currently visiting professor at several Civil law countries as well in Common law countries. Some of the universities where he has been or is still visiting professor of law include including the University of Hong Kong; National University of Malaysia (UKM), the National University of Singapore, University of Malaya, Kings College (London), Universitas Indonesia, Padjajaran University (Indonesia) and Queen Mary, University of London.

He has given expert evidence under the Brunei/Malaysian/Indian Contracts Acts and Specific Relief Acts and is regularly consulted by law firms from those jurisdictions on complex disputes.

Current Positions on International Committees

He is a Member of the ICC Commission on Arbitration (Task Force on the New York Convention and Task Force of ADR); Advisory Committee Member of the China – ASEAN Legal Research Centre; Vice President of Asia Pacific Regional Arbitration Group (APRAG); Member of the ICCA-Queen Mary Task Force on Third-Party Funding in International Arbitration and a Co-Chair of the International Bar Association’s Arbitration Asia-Pacific Group (until January 2023).

Previous Positions on International Committees

He has been a consultant to the ASEAN Centre for Energy in Jakarta. He has been a member of the panel of the ASEAN Protocol on Enhanced Dispute Settlement Mechanism (nominee of Brunei Darussalam). In 2011, Dr Ong was listed by Global Arbitration Review as one of the 45 leading international arbitration practitioners under the age of 45. He is a former vice chairman of the IBA arbitration committee; a former vice president of the LCIA Asia Pacific Users Council and a former Vice Chair of the Arbitration Committee of the Inter Pacific Bar Association. He was one of the draftsmen of the current Brunei domestic and international arbitration statutes and was a core drafting member of the Malaysian PAM 2006 Standard Building Forms of Contract.
